So summieren Sie horizontale Zellen basierend auf dem Wert der Zelle in Excel rechts davon

316
Peach_kefir

Ich versuche, die monatlichen "Arbeitsstunden" -Daten zusammenzufassen. Jede Zeile ist wie dieses Beispiel formatiert. Dieses Beispiel ist eine Woche für zwei Mitarbeiter

Louie, 8, solar, 9, service, 8, solar, 8, solar, 7, service  Chuck, 8, solar, 8, solar, 8, solar, 9, service, 8, solar 

Ich möchte das berechnen können:

Louie arbeitete 24 Stunden im Solar- und 16 Stunden im Service.

Chuck arbeitete 32 Stunden im Solar- und 9 Stunden im Service.

Es ist so formatiert, dass ich die täglichen Arbeitsstunden in Solar oder den Service für alle Mitarbeiter täglich zusammenfassen kann. Mit einer Sumif-Funktion ist das einfach. Um diese wöchentlich oder monatlich zu kalkulieren, hat mich das gereizt. Gibt es eine Funktion oder muss ich meine Daten anders speichern?

0

1 Antwort auf die Frage

1
Scott Craner

Verwenden Sie SUMPRODUCT ():

=SUMPRODUCT(A1:J1,--(B1:K1="solar")) 

Für Service Ändern Sie "solar"in"service"

Danke Scott, das hat mein Problem gelöst. Sehr interessante Funktion! Peach_kefir vor 7 Jahren 0